FOURTH COHORT OF SCHOLARS GRADUATE FROM 10,000 SMALL BUSINESSES PROGRAM IN PHILADELPHIA

      On August 22, 2014, 32 Philadelphia entrepreneurs, the largest class for Philadelphia so far, graduated from the Goldman Sachs 10,000 Small Businesses education program at the Community College of Philadelphia, bringing the total number of scholars to 110.

STORMWATER MANAGEMENT INCENTIVES PROGRAM AND GREENED ACRE RETROFIT PROGRAM NOW ACCEPTED ON A ROLLING BASIS

The City of Philadelphia, through the Philadelphia Water Department (PWD) and PIDC, has created the Stormwater Management Incentives Program (SMIP) and the Greened Acre Retrofit Program (GARP) to offer incentives and assistance to non-residential PWD customers and contractors.

PIDC ANNOUNCES RECEIPT OF $38 MILLION IN NEW MARKETS TAX CREDIT ALLOCATION

Philadelphia Industrial Development Corporation (PIDC) announced the award of a $38 million in New Markets Tax Credit (NMTC) allocation from the U.S. Treasury Department’s Community Development Financial Institutions (CDFI) Fund.
